Gunfire disrupts quiet Salisbury neighborhood as deputies search for leads

December 4, 2024

Salisbury, MD – Deputies from the Wicomico County Sheriff’s Office investigated a shooting incident Tuesday on Rockawalkin Ridge Road. The incident was reported at approximately 3:15 PM, and involved multiple individuals shooting at each other.

A Wicomico County school bus was nearby during the incident, but authorities confirmed that no students were involved or in immediate danger. Deputies quickly secured the area to safeguard residents and conducted a search for suspects or victims.

The Wicomico County Sheriff’s Office found evidence at the scene, but no suspects or victims. The office continues to investigate and is seeking additional information from the public.
